powered by simpleCommunicator - 2.0.59     © 2025 Programmizd 02
Целевая тема:
Создать новую тему:
Автор:
Закрыть
Цитировать
Форумы / FoxPro, Visual FoxPro [игнор отключен] [закрыт для гостей] / не работают события на нажатия клавиш в гриде в VFP8, запускаю проект в VFP6
6 сообщений из 6, страница 1 из 1
не работают события на нажатия клавиш в гриде в VFP8, запускаю проект в VFP6
    #32239878
Valera Pochernin
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
не работают события на нажатия клавиш в гриде в VFP8, точнее работают, но частично! Запускаю проект в VFP6, все ок ! В чем может быть проблема ?
...
Рейтинг: 0 / 0
не работают события на нажатия клавиш в гриде в VFP8, запускаю проект в VFP6
    #32239908
Aijik
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Какие именно клавиши, какая именно форма?
На сегодня известен такой баг VFP8:
KeyPress контролов и самой формы не отрабатывают по клавише F5, если форма имеет Closable = .T.
Именно это имеет место быть?
...
Рейтинг: 0 / 0
не работают события на нажатия клавиш в гриде в VFP8, запускаю проект в VFP6
    #32239912
Aijik
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Сорри, Closable = .F. имелся в виду
...
Рейтинг: 0 / 0
не работают события на нажатия клавиш в гриде в VFP8, запускаю проект в VFP6
    #32240520
ValeraP
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Да, именно клавиша F5 не срабатывает !
Но при этом св-во формы Closable = .T. !!!
TitleBar=0

Как это вылечить ?
...
Рейтинг: 0 / 0
не работают события на нажатия клавиш в гриде в VFP8, запускаю проект в VFP6
    #32240611
Aijik
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Но при этом св-во формы Closable = .T. !!!

При описанных вами условиях с Closable = .T. и TitleBar=0 у меня F5 работает (мож всё-таки Closable = .F.?)
Насчет того как бороться - сам хотел бы узнать (самостоятельно упорно обхода не искал - у меня в прогах не встречается сладкой парочки "форма с Closable=.F. + обработка F5 в Keypress", поэтому не слишком волнует пока).
Насчет лечения пути следующие:
1. Повесить обработку на ON KEY LABEL F5 - такой финт не глючит
2. Заплатить за Premier Membership на сайте UniversalThread и прочитать ветку №796465 в ихней фоксовой конференции, где этот баг обсуждался, чтобы узнать чё народ в ней родил. В списке багов на UT написано, что обходные пути были предложены
3. Найти человека, который имеет Premier Membership и попросить посмотреть его (народ, кто имеет, откликнитесь... :))
4. Запускать прогу только под средой с открытым Дебаггером (баг при этом исчезает). Модет показаться глупой шуткой, но это правда работает :)
5. Забить на все и ждать SP1 на восьмой фокс в сентябре (что сомнительно, задержат 100%, гады :)) MS баг вроде как официально признал, а значит в SP1 должны исправить.
...
Рейтинг: 0 / 0
не работают события на нажатия клавиш в гриде в VFP8, запускаю проект в VFP6
    #32240837
ValeraP
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Повесил обработку на ON KEY LABEL F5 все ок !
Но такое решение не самое лучшее.
Будем ждать SP1 !
И все таки св-во формы Closable = .T. !!!
TitleBar=0
Спасибо за помошь.
...
Рейтинг: 0 / 0
6 сообщений из 6, страница 1 из 1
Форумы / FoxPro, Visual FoxPro [игнор отключен] [закрыт для гостей] / не работают события на нажатия клавиш в гриде в VFP8, запускаю проект в VFP6
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]